### Account Recovery — Catalogue Import (Lintwood)

Quick one for review: when the Lintwood catalogue import wipes a patron's session table, the recovery flow re-seeds accounts from the nightly snapshot. Check that the importer skips locked accounts — last time it didn't. To rerun recovery against staging you'll need the vault passphrase, which is appended just below.

recovery phrase for yafof-tajof: julmir-kelax-julvan-holath-belvan-holir-ralael-ralvan-ralath-julvan-silmir-istmir-kaswyn-ulamir

Welcome to the Pellago API team. Our public REST API uses cursor-based pagination: pass the opaque cursor from each response's next field, and never construct cursors manually. Default page size is 50, max 200. Cursors are signed server-side; the staging signing keystore is encrypted and you'll need to unlock it for local testing. Unlock it using the recovery passphrase below.

unlock words, tawif-tahop: oliys-ulawyn-tamdor-lamys-casox-jormir-fraius-kasath-ulador-ulamir-holir-sorys-holeth

**Ticket: Slim the Varnholt gateway container image**

The current gateway image ships a full build toolchain and package caches, widening the attack surface unnecessarily. Proposal: switch to a two-stage build, strip debug symbols, and base the runtime layer on our minimal Quellen base image. I've verified no runtime dependency on the removed compilers, and the SBOM diff shows 212 fewer packages. Please review the layer diff before we promote to staging. The candidate build token is recorded below.

trace token, kajeg-bajop: htk6_46382d